4-Amino-3-hydroxybenzoic acid
- CAS No.: 2374-03-0
- Formula:C7H7NO3
- Molecular Weight:153.14
IUPAC Name: 4-amino-3-hydroxybenzoic acid
InChIKey: NFPYJDZQOKCYIE-UHFFFAOYSA-N
SMILES: NC1=CC=C(C(O)=O)C=C1O
Biological Activity: 4-Amino-3-hydroxybenzoic acid is an aromatic substrate degradable by Bordetella sp. strain 10d. 4-Amino-3-hydroxybenzoic acid can serve as a carbon source, nitrogen source and energy source for the growth of Bordetella sp. strain 10d. 4-Amino-3-hydroxybenzoic acid acts as a substrate for 2-amino-5-carboxymuconate-6-semialdehyde deaminase and 4-amino-3-hydroxybenzoate 2,3-dioxygenase[1][2].
